Evergreen State
Reviewed in the United States on September 22, 2020
This is not airsoft garbage, it is built for abuse.All the metal hardware is thick and stout. It appears to be treated steel. The attachment loops take some real strength to open and close- how you want them. The metal clasp is anchored to the canvas sling with 3 large rivets and pressure teeth, very stout.The sling material itself is tough. It appears to be high quality canvas, or something similar, not nylon.The adjustment length is perfect for my AK. Mine is pictured in its shortest setting, but length can be added if you want some more wiggle room.Is it real Russian military manufacture? Tough to say. Mine has a "2015" (2013?) stamp but that could be faked. Nothing I see can confirm or deny its origin. Either way, its got a great milsurp look and is built TOUGH. Buy with confidence.

Mine contained a charming little insert that read "inspected by Vlad" with accompanying Cyrillic. The product screams "functionality" and "utility" that you'd expect out of genuine un-issued milsurp. All of the components are sturdy and can endure whatever punishment you throw at them. The thickness of the sling enhances comfort with larger caliber rifles, (I tried it on my m14 with a full 25 round mag, and it felt really good, and we're talking about 10-12 pounds worth of hardware). I'd recommend hitting the canvas with scotchgard if you're planning on throwing it on a hunting rifle, or if you live in a climate with heavy humidity. I have it on a vz58 and it just looks and feels great. As someone mentioned, if you care about the metal components scratching the finish on your safe queen, either hit the clasps with a rubberized spraypaint or a medium then high grit sand paper on the toothier areas, or just go with a more suitable sling (something to the tune of deerskin or buffalo leather, heavily oiled with Chicago screws).
